I was first introduced to The Wolves Of Willoughby Chase through the 1989 British-made film of the same name starring Stephanie Beacham (Miss Slighcarp), Mel Smith (Mr. Grimshaw), Emily Hudson (Bonnie), and Aleks Darowska (Sylvia). It puts one foot right with the production/costume design, as it creates an imaginary 19th Century Britain ruled by King James III and overrun by wolves, and another in the general area with the casting of Stephanie Beacham - best known for The Colbys, although we remember her as a dolly bird in Dracula AD 1972, House Of Mortal Sin and Inseminoid - as Letitia Slighcarp, the wicked governess who takes over Willoughby Chase and makes things rotten for the precocious Bonnie and Sylvia. The Wolves of Willoughby Chase is a children's novel by Joan Aiken, first published in 1963.Set in an alternate history of England, it tells of the adventures of cousins Bonnie and Sylvia and their friend Simon the goose-boy as they thwart the evil schemes of their governess Miss Slighcarp.. Biopic [feature] Satire Musical Drama Black Comedy Period Film Sports Drama. Time Out says. Well, here, adapted from Joan Aiken’s well-loved children’s adventure, is an attempt to revive the genre. There are lots of theoretically enjoyable things here - creeping around secret passageways, an oppressive orphanage-cum-laundry where our heroines are tempted, a steam-driven Snow Cat for the final chase scene, lovely frocks - but you keep cringing as the actors overdo the accents in an attempt to wring some sort of reaction from a generation of kids weaned on Transformers and the Care Bears. Newcomers Emily Hudson and Aleks Darowska played Bonnie and Sylvia. The cast includes Stephanie Beacham as Miss Slighcarp, Mel Smith as Mr. Grimshaw, Geraldine James as Mrs. Brisket, Richard O'Brien as James, and Jane Horrocksas Pattern. The Wolves of Willoughby Chase is set in an alternative history of a "nineteenth-century Britain that was already linked to Europe by a tunnel through which wolves freely roamed" (ODNB). Based on the much-loved children's book by Joan Aitken and made in 1989, this spooky family film is a classic Dickensian-gothic tale of resourceful children, evil governesses, forged wills, cruel orphanages and goodness triumphant - all taking place in a remote and isolated country house. This dark and atmospheric fantasy sees Lord and Lady Willoughby heading overseas - leaving their daughter Bonnie (Emily Hudson) and her orphaned cousin Sylvia (Aleks Darowska) left in the care of the children’s new governess: the sinister Miss Slightcarp (Stephanie Beacham).
